Military aviators are required to wear gloves at all times. The reason is that in case of (a ****pit) fire, you still have to keep your hands on the controls to get the bird down on the ground. Much less true when racing or tracking (only in that you don't have to 'fly it down'), but I'd always wear gloves. Always. Less for the grip and more for the protection. Fire is very very bad.
On the road, the danger is miniscule. And you definitely look like a dork.
